Comprehending Pocket Door Locks
Before diving into the replacement process, it's necessary to understand the elements and functionalities of pocket door locks. Unlike basic door locks, pocket door locks frequently have specific shapes and sizes distinct to the style of the pocket door. Here are 2 typical types of pocket door locks:
| Lock Type | Description |
|---|---|
| Privacy Lock | Normally utilized in restrooms and bed rooms, enabling for security without a secret. |
| Passage Lock | Used for doors that don't require locking however still require a handle mechanism. |

Tools Needed for Replacement
Before beginning the replacement job, ensure that you have the following tools on hand:
| Tool | Purpose |
|---|---|
| Screwdriver | To eliminate screws holding the lock in location. |
| Measuring Tape | For measuring measurements of the new lock. |
| Replacement Lock Kit | The new lock with all elements needed. |
| Drill (optional) | For producing new holes, if necessary. |
| Level | To ensure your lock is lined up appropriately. |
| Safety glasses | For eye protection. |
Step-by-Step Replacement Procedure
Now that you have your tools prepared, let's dive into the replacement procedure.
Action 1: Remove the Old Lock
Clear the Area: Ensure that the pocket door is unobstructed.
Unscrew the Faceplate: Using your screwdriver, get rid of the screws securing the faceplate of the old lock.
Secure the Lock Mechanism: Gently slide out the lock mechanism from the door.
Pointer: Take note of how the old lock is set up, consisting of the orientation and positioning of components.
Action 2: Measure for New Lock
- Measure the Lock Slot: Use a measuring tape to determine the width and height of the lock slot.
- Select a Compatible Replacement: Ensure your new lock fits the measurements taken. Quality lock sets frequently come with size standards.
Action 3: Install the New Lock
- Insert the New Lock: Slide the new lock mechanism into the ready space in the keyless door locks.
- Attach the Faceplate: Align the faceplate with the new mechanism and secure it with screws.
- Examine Alignment with Level: Use a level to ensure the lock is straight and lined up correctly before tightening up all screws.
Step 4: Test the Lock
- Test the Mechanism: Slide the door open and closed numerous times to make sure the lock functions efficiently.
- Inspect for Sticking or Jamming: If the lock sticks, ensure it is correctly aligned. You may require to adjust screws or rearrange the lock somewhat for ideal function.
Upkeep Tips for Pocket Door Locks
To lengthen the life of your new lock, consider these upkeep tips:
- Regular Cleaning: Dust and debris can impact the lock's operation. Tidy it regularly.
- Lubrication: Apply a silicone-based lubricant to the lock mechanism regularly. Prevent oil-based items as they can attract dirt.
- Regular Checks: Regularly evaluate the lock to capture any problems early before they need major repair work.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: How do I know if my pocket door lock needs changing?
A1: Signs consist of trouble in turning the lock, the door not latching effectively, or visible wear and tear on the mechanism.
Q2: Can I change a pocket door lock without professional aid?
A2: Yes, lots of homeowners can replace a pocket door lock separately with the right tools and assistance.
Q3: Are all pocket door locks the same size?
A3: No, pocket door locks differ in size and style. It's vital to determine your existing lock or the door slot before buying a replacement.
Q4: How long does it normally require to replace a pocket door lock?
A4: The procedure usually takes around 30 minutes to an hour, depending on your experience level and the lock style.

Q5: What if I can't discover a precise match for my existing lock?
A5: If a precise match isn't available, think about a universal pocket door lock or seek advice from a hardware expert for alternatives.
